NOW
Lightscape 2025 is an after-dark wonderland filled with light installations and immersive soundscapes in Kings Park and Botanical Garden in Perth, WA. You can also enjoy food and drinks under the stars.
WHEN: Until July 27; bgpa.wa.gov.au
COMING UP
The Christmas in July Festival in Sydney will transform the Rocks' historic laneways with the sights, sounds and smells of a European winter including pop-up restaurants, stalls, fairy lights, fondue, mulled wine, a forest of real pine trees and seasonal cheer.
WHEN: July 11 to 20; christmasinjuly.com.au
LATER
Darwin Festival will feature 734 artists and 402 performances across a record 50 venues. Guy Sebastian, Sarah Blasko and Suhani Shah are some of the big names to play the festival, alongside comedians, visual artists and opera singers, and it will also host the 2025 National Indigenous Music Awards.
WHEN: August 7-24; darwinfestival.org.au

Don't miss out on the headlines from Entertainment. Followed categories will be added to My News. Nine reporter Hannah Sinclair has married her longtime partner in a lavish Bali wedding. The network's European correspondent exchanged vows with Mitch Burke on a clifftop with panoramic ocean views on Friday, with guests sharing photos of the celebrations on social media. Sinclair, who moved to London from Sydney late last year, wore an elegant spaghetti strap silk gown, and opted for a broadbrimmed hat over a traditional veil. Nine reporter Hannah Sinclair married her partner Mitch Burke in Bali. The couple said 'I do' at a stunning venue on a cliff. Burke, for his part, wore a white tuxedo jacket with a black bow tie. The aisle, which Sinclair walked down with her mother, was set atop a pool of water and lined with bouquets of flowers. The aisle was adorned with flowers. The couple said 'I do' under an archway of flowers with the sweeping ocean view in the background. Changing into a bubble hem mini dress for the reception, Sinclair's guests shared videos of the fairy-light covered dance floor and fireworks display. Among guests included Sinclair's Nine colleagues Gabrielle Boyle, Lizzie Pearl, Ashley Carter and Tim Davies. An outfit change for the reception. The pair danced the night away. It comes after Sinclair held her hen's party in Canggu the night before her wedding day, sharing wild photos and videos as she danced the night away with a group of friends who were all dressed in pink. 'I have the best family and friends in the world,' Sinclair wrote. Sinclair's hen's party was held the night before the wedding. The journalist, who started her career with Southern Cross Austereo in Tasmania, first joined Nine's Perth bureau in 2016, before moving to Sydney two years later. Sinclair took up a role with A Current Affair in 2021, and was later promoted to her current correspondent gig which she started in September last year. Hannah is the European correspondent for Nine. Sharing the news on Instagram at the time, Sinclair said working in London was her 'dream job'.
